How Souttia Enhances Brand Identity
Typography plays a crucial role in how a brand is perceived. A well-chosen font can make a business feel more trustworthy, creative, or approachable. Souttia sits in that sweet spot between casual and polished, making it versatile for different industries.
When used consistently across branding materials—like business cards, website banners, and Instagram templates—it helps create a cohesive visual identity. This consistency builds recognition and trust, which are essential for small businesses trying to stand out.
One thing I noticed is that Souttia works best for short phrases and headlines rather than long blocks of text. It’s not designed for body copy, but as a display font, it shines in logos, titles, and decorative elements. Pairing it with a clean sans serif or serif font can balance its expressive style with readability.
Practical Tips for Using Souttia
If you’re considering Souttia for your brand, here are a few tips to keep in mind:
- Use it for headlines and logos—Souttia’s personality comes through best in short, impactful text.
- Test it on small labels and mobile screens—make sure it remains legible at different sizes and resolutions.
- Pair it with a complementary font—a simple sans serif like Lato or Montserrat can provide contrast and clarity.
- Check the file formats and licensing—ensure it’s suitable for your intended use, whether it’s print, web, or digital marketing.
Also, take time to explore the font’s alternate characters and ligatures. These features can add subtle variations that make your designs feel more unique and tailored.
